Why you drop out of online wine tasting courses
Discover why most self-paced online wine courses lead to low engagement and high dropout rates, and completion rates can be as low as 5–15% for free courses.
Wine Tasting Coach, Dr. Isabelle Lesschaeve, describes the “lonely learner trap” of on-demand programs with no live instructor interaction, feedback, or accountability, and argues that tasting is a skill built through sensing, repetition, calibration, and real-time validation—not memorizing descriptors or theory.
She recommends cohort- and community-based, instructor-led training with live touchpoints, which research shows can achieve up to 80% completion.
